Taqueria Mexico

Led by the tip of one of our readers Sean Martin (feel free to keep e-mailing us your favorite hot spots, we read every e-mail!), we decided to check out this 24 hour abode. Humbly situated in the safety of the city of Orange, in between a 7-Eleven, Subway and an attached Donut Shop. Boasting a simple menu (tacos and burritos) and quick service, coupled with one of the most uninspired names I’ve seen in awhile, Taqueria Mexico is actually, definitely where it’s at.
